Achena Mukh is an Indian Bengali-language thriller drama film directed by Ajit Lahiri[1] and produced by Nani Gangopadhyay[2][3] based on a novel of Shaktipada Rajguru. The film was released on 27 June 1986 under the banner of Elam Films.[4]
Plot
Subimal Mukherjee, an idealistic young man, takes up a job as a mine manager. He opposes the exploitation of workers by the mining mafia and strikes up a friendship with Koiree, one of the workers. At Subimal's call, a strike is launched at the mine. Some unscrupulous leader seek the help of local goon Shobhanlal to break the strike.
